The average Priority Health Data Scientist earns an estimated $142,135 annually, which includes an estimated base salary of $120,693 with a $21,442 bonus. Priority Health's Data Scientist compensation is $12,630 more than the US average for a Data Scientist. Data Scientist salaries at Priority Health can range from $50,000 - $350,000.
The Engineering Department at Priority Health earns $11,659 more on average than the Design Department.

Data Scientists earn $101 more than Lead Engineers, and $12,572 less than Principal Engineers.
The Engineering Department averages $11,659 more than the Design Department, and $13,335 less than the Product Department
The average female Data Scientist at companies similar size to Priority Health reported making $130,809, while the average male Data Scientist at similar sized companies reported making $143,579.
The average Asian or Pacific Islander Data Scientist at companies similar size to Priority Health reported making $144,794, while the average Native American Data Scientist at similar sized companies reported making $102,000.
